Mumford & Sons’ Ben Lovett – HuffPost 10.12.11

Mike Ragogna: Ben, what advice do you have for new artists?

Ben Lovett: I guess my advice would be there’s no better way than working hard when it comes to being a musician. You can’t fast track your way to stardom, and there’s much misunderstanding about how the media has created shows, and the record industry has encouraged these hype machines. It doesn’t compare to writing good songs; and spend time on writing good songs. Also, just getting out there and playing shows, it’s better to go that way than the fast way, it’s a lot more satisfying that’s for sure.
